Transaction 64ffd5ae2427738e1733dc505cad0f578863a7a7172c1aff83fd8c7978871008

1 Input
2 Outputs
  • 64ffd5ae2427738e1733dc505cad0f578863a7a7172c1aff83fd8c7978871008:0
  • value  4510569969
    address  3KdfMvZsrjM5Qe4CPEAPxdJLgmyQ5CpSpd
  • 64ffd5ae2427738e1733dc505cad0f578863a7a7172c1aff83fd8c7978871008:1
  • value  2258427
    address  3FU3KDeSaRGa7HBsA7um7Wy9t1d5a85wXi